Dr Evina Katsou is a Visiting Professor in the Department of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ering within the College of Engineering, Design and Physical Sciences at Brunel University London. She serves as Course Director for the Water Engineering MSc program and leads the Water & Environmental Engineering research group with 20 researchers. Dr Katsou's educational background includes a PhD in 'Wastewater Treatment with the Use of Membranes' (2008-2011), an MSc in Water Resources Science & Technology (2006-2008), and an MEng in Chemical Engineering (2000-2005), all from the National Technical University of Athens (NTUA), Greece. Her research program focuses on three interconnected areas: (1) Sustainable resource recovery from wastewater and safe reuse; (2) Data analytics, knowledge discovery and process modelling; and (3) Circularity & sustainability measurement and assessment. Dr Katsou has developed innovative approaches for biological nutrient removal from wastewater, including partial nitrification/denitrification and complete autotrophic nitrogen removal processes. Her work integrates advanced data analytics methods such as multivariate statistics, clustering techniques, machine learning algorithms, and artificial neural networks to identify complex relationships between process variables, particularly for measuring GHG emissions in water treatment systems. Dr Katsou has authored 98 journal publications (h-index: 27) and 12 book chapters with over 100 presentations, and holds a patent on biopolymers recovery. Her recent publications demonstrate a strong focus on circular economy applications in water systems, nature-based solutions for urban environments, and resource recovery technologies. The research trends show increasing integration of data-driven decision support systems with environmental sustainability metrics, particularly in the water-energy-food nexus domain. She has secured substantial research funding as Principal Investigator on 11 national and international projects including RESILEX Horizon Europe, SYMBIOREM Horizon Europe, BORECER Horizon Europe, HYDROUSA H2020, and WATER-MINING H2020. Her industrial consulting portfolio includes significant contracts with leading UK water industry partners such as Affinity Water, Arup, Severn Trent, and Anglian Water, with projects ranging from carbon footprint assessment to corrosion mitigation and process optimization. She leads the Transformation Tools group of the Cost Action on Circular Cities, co-leads the Circular Water VLT of Water Europe, and co-leads the SMART-WATER group of the ICT4Water Cluster-EC. Dr Katsou is also a member of the drafting team for new ISO standards on Circular Economy (Measuring and Assessing Circularity - ISO5902).
